Lan Zhanfei, a famous gaming streamer turned travel influencer, is known online as “the freest Chinese man on the internet” for his carefree journeys across China and around the world. In early December, however, that image was shaken by a traumatic experience in South Africa.
On December 9, 2025, Lan posted a series of messages on Sina Weibo describing how he was kidnapped inside a five-star hotel in Cape Town. He claimed that two armed suspects, allegedly aided by someone inside the hotel, used a key to enter his suite. They allegedly detained him for four to five hours, initially demanding a ransom. When that failed, they forced him to apply for online loans.
Before leaving, Lan claims the kidnappers photographed him nude and collected biological samples, including fingerprints, saliva and hair, Chinese news outlet Guancha reported. Lan said the perpetrators threatened to fabricate a rape case using the materials if he reported the crime.
After the suspects left, Lan contacted South African authorities and the Chinese embassy. The case was formally filed with South African police on December 10, though he was reportedly told the chances of solving it were slim.
Born in 1992 in Yunfu, Guangdong Province, Lan began his career as a professional e-sports player before transitioning into livestreaming. In March 2023, he shifted his focus to travel content, launching a six-month journey across China that documented both scenic locations and physical challenges.
His travels later expanded into a global expedition covering Asia, Europe, the Americas and Antarctica. His videos, which feature everything from hot air balloon rides in Türkiye to ice diving in Lake Baikal, have earned him more than 26 million followers on Douyin.
